Putney Swope
Putney Swope ★★★ 1969 (R)
Comedy about a token black ad man mistakenly elected Chairman of the board of a Madison Avenue ad agency who turns the company upsidedown. A series of riotous spoofs on commercials is the highpoint in this funny, though somewhat dated look at big business. 84m/B VHS, DVD . Arnold Johnson, Laura Greene, Stanley Gottlieb, Mel Brooks; D: Robert Downey; W: Robert Downey; C: Gerald Cotts; M: Charles Cura.
